Who we are.

Solo enables companies to Connect, Secure and Observe modern applications – APIs, Microservices and Data – with the industry’s leading API and Service Mesh Management Platform (“Gloo”). Solo innovations allow companies to stay on the leading edge of both technology and business possibilities.

Solo is a VC-backed company, founded in 2017 by Idit Levine. In 2021, Solo was valued at $1B. Solo’s customers are some of the largest in the world, spanning all geographies and industries. Solo’s team has deep expertise in Cloud Computing, Linux, Containers, Kubernetes, Service Mesh, APIs, Security, Microservice Applications, Application Modernization, GraphQL, and eBPF.

About the role.

We are looking for a Revenue Operations Engineer to help build, maintain, and evolve the technical foundation of our go-to-market systems. This role sits at the intersection of data engineering, analytics, systems administration, and applied software engineering. You will work across Sales, Marketing, Customer Success, Finance, Engineering, and Content to ensure our revenue data is accurate, accessible, and actionable. This is not a narrowly scoped analyst role. You will be expected to operate in ambiguous problem spaces, independently propose solutions, and seamlessly navigate a diverse technical stack—from Salesforce to dbt models to terminals to APIs—often tackling multiple systems. If you enjoy figuring things out when the requirements are incomplete, documenting what you learn, and teaching others how systems actually work, this role is designed for you.

Job Description:

• Data & Analytics Engineering

• Build, maintain, and optimize data pipelines that support revenue, marketing, and customer analytics.

• Develop and maintain analytical models using dbt, ensuring data is reliable, well-documented, and reusable.

• Own data transformations and modeling logic across core GTM datasets (leads, accounts, opportunities, product usage, revenue).

• Partner with stakeholders to translate vague business questions into testable data models.

• Systems & Integrations

• Configure, monitor, and troubleshoot data syncs using tools such as:

FivetranBigQuery Data TransferAirbyte (Open Source)

• Ensure data integrity across Salesforce, Marketo, and downstream analytics platforms.

• Diagnose sync issues, schema changes, and upstream system quirks before they become business problems.

• Cross-Functional Problem Solving

• Gather requirements from nearly every business unit:

• Sales, Marketing, Customer Success, Finance, Engineering, Solutions Engineering, Content Marketing

• Navigate incomplete or conflicting inputs and independently determine:

• What the actual problem is

• What the simplest viable solution is

• What a better long-term solution might be

• Document decisions, assumptions, and tradeoffs so others can follow and learn.

• Experimentation & Solution Design

• Ideate, hypothesize, and test solutions without needing explicit step-by-step instructions.

• Leverage AI tools (including OpenAI APIs, copilots, etc.) to accelerate experimentation and iteration.

• Challenge existing approaches and propose improvements—even when the current solution “works.”

• End-to-End Ownership

• Manage multiple projects and shifting priorities in parallel.

• Move comfortably between:

• Salesforce configuration

• SQL and dbt modeling

• Terminal-based debugging

• API testing

• Light web development or tooling (e.g., internal utilities)

• Perform end-to-end testing across systems (e.g., from form fill → Marketo → Salesforce → warehouse → dashboard).

Job Requirements:

• 1–4 years of experience in Revenue Operations, Analytics Engineering, Data Engineering, or Sales/Marketing Systems.

• Strong working knowledge of SQL and relational data modeling concepts.

• Hands-on experience with at least one modern analytics stack (e.g., BigQuery + dbt).

• Comfort operating in ambiguous environments with minimal direction.

• Ability to explain technical concepts clearly to non-technical stakeholders.

• Confidence to challenge assumptions and suggest better approaches.
